Quantifying farmland shelterbelt impacts on catchment soil erosion and sediment yield for the black soil region, northeastern China

Haiyan Fang

Summary: This study estimated the impact of farmland shelterbelts on soil erosion rate and sediment yield using a model in northeastern China, finding that the shelterbelts can reduce soil erosion and sediment yield to some extent. Additionally, the study found that sediment trap efficiencies were significantly correlated with shelterbelt density, catchment perimeter, topographic factors, and land use patterns.

Establishing an ecological forest system of salt-tolerant plants in heavily saline wasteland using the drip-irrigation reclamation method

Shide Dong et al.

Summary: Through drip irrigation and planting salt-tolerant plants, this study effectively reduced soil salinity and improved soil fertility. However, maintaining the appropriate SMP threshold is crucial for maintaining salt balance and plant growth.
